> At 01:33 -0400 07/26/02, Carl Sheperd wrote: >> I have just purchased a PTP machine and will want to add RAM to it >> as it only has 64M. I have no manual for it and do not know if it >> need EDO or non-EDO memory. Also I am not sure if I can use 128M or >> if I have to use 64M chips. I see that both OWC and Techworks list >> both types, but one is considerably cheaper than the other. Are the >> Techworks memory chips that much better than OWC? I would >> appreciate some advice from those of you who know. Thanks, --Carl
The original Power Computing specs for the PowerTowerPro series called for 168 pin Fast page Mode, 70 ns, or faster, DIMM's. OWC had a sale awhile back on suitable EDO DIMM's., I bought a bunch of their stock number OWC5MD128MBE, 60 ns, EDO, DIMM's. Worked great.
